A Computational Functional Tissue Unit of the Human Myometrium for <i>In Silico</i> Study of Gestational Excitability and Pathophysiology
2026-05-09
Abstract excerpt
The human myometrium undergoes a dramatic transformation during pregnancy, shifting from quiescence to highly synchronised contractility. Understanding this transition is crucial for addressing pathologies such as preterm labour and dystocia (ineffective labour).
